| Manufacturer | Omron |
|---|---|
| Product Line | R88D |
| Part Number | R88D-WT05H |
| Weight | 12.00 lbs (5.44 kg) |
| Name | AC Servo Driver |
| Input Voltage | 200 VAC |
| Input Voltage Phases | 3-phase |
| Rated Current | 3.8 Amps |
| Motor Capacity | 500 Watts |
| Ambient Operating Temperature | 0 to 55°C |
| Ambient Storage Temperature | -20 to 85°C |
| Ambient Operating Humidity | 90% RH or less (no condensation) |
| Ambient Storage Humidity | 90% RH or less (no condensation) |
| Input Command Signal | Analog/Pulse Common Inputs |
| Storage and Operating Environment | No Corrosive Gases |
Omron's R88D-WT05H AC servo driver is built for reliable operation in various industrial environments. It operates at a three-phase input voltage of 200 VAC. The device generates a rated current of 3.8 Amps and has a maximum motor capacity of 500 Watts, allowing it to effectively cater to different servo motor applications.
This unit is intended for operation in temperatures ranging from 0 to 55°C, ensuring suitability for various operational settings. The storage conditions allow a broader temperature range of -20 to 85°C. It can withstand ambient humidity levels of 90% RH or lower, and no condensation should be present during operation or storage. It's important to note that the operational environment should be free from corrosive gases, ensuring the longevity of the component.
The R88D-WT05H accepts input command signals through analog or pulse common inputs to control the motor accurately. This capability enhances its integration into existing systems while maintaining robust performance.
